过敏性紫癜患儿尿表皮生长因子水平变化及意义探讨  被引量:2

Significance of Urine Epidermal Growth Factor Level in Children with Henoch-Schonlein Purpur Nephritis

摘  要:目的:探讨过敏性紫癜(HSP)患儿尿表皮生长因子(EGF)水平变化在早期肾损害中的意义。方法:采用双抗体夹心ELISA方法检测91例过敏性紫癜患儿和30例正常对照组儿童的尿表皮生长因子。结果:(1)HSP患儿尿EGF水平为(78.59±18.09)μg/L,明显高于正常对照组(29.30±13.92)μg/L,有统计学差异(t值为13.64,P<0.01)(。2)HSP各临床分型间比较发现紫癜肾型尿EGF水平(98.31±17.68)μg/L,分别高于其他临床型:皮肤型(78.76±12.66)μg/L,腹型(77.16±11.77)μg/L,关节型(76.49±17.45)μg/L,混合型(77.71±13.49)μg/L,均有统计学差异(P均<0.05),而其余各临床分型间比较无统计学意义(P均>0.05)。结论:HSP患儿尿EGF水平明显增高,EGF在HSP伴有肾损害者早期升高尤为明显,考虑EGF增高可能与HSP病理改变程度有关,因此,EGF在过敏性紫癜肾损害的发生中具有重要意义。Objective:To investigate the value of urine epidermal growth factor(EGF) concentration in early diagnosis of Henoch- Schonlein Purpura nephritis (HSPN) in children. Methods:Bi - antibody ELISA was used to measure urine EGF levels in 91 HSP and 30 healthy children. Results: (1)The urine EGF concentration in lISP patientswas significantly higher than that of control group [ (78.59 ± 18.09)μg/L vs (29.30 ± 13.92)μg/L, P 〈 0.01 ]. (2) Urine EGF concentration in purpura nephropathy [ (89.31 ± 17.68 )μg/L] was significantly higher than that in any other types: skin type [(78.76± 12.66)μg/L], abdominal type [(77.16 ± 11.77) μg/L] ,joint type [(76.49 ± 17.45)μg/L] and mixed type [ (77.71 ±13.49)μg/L] all P 〈0.05), but there were no statistical significance among the latter four types (both P 〉0.05). Conclusion: The concentration of urine EGF increases in HSP chidren, especially in early stage of HSPN. The increase of EGF level may be associated with pathological change in HSP. Urine EGF level can be used as one of sensitive indictors in early kidney damage of HSP.
